Vietnam expected to welcome more ASEAN tourists this year

More than 100 foreign partners have signed cooperation deals and contracts and pledged to bring tourists to Vietnam within two days at the Travel Exchange (TRAVEX) Trade Fair 2024 in Laos.

Vientiane (VNA) – More than 100 foreign partners have signed cooperation dealsand contracts and pledged to bring tourists to Vietnam within two days at the TravelExchange (TRAVEX) Trade Fair 2024 in Laos.

TRAVEX2024, the biggest of its kind held annually in the Association of SoutheastAsian Nations (ASEAN), took place from January 24-26 with the participationof localities and businesses from ASEAN member countries.

The pavilionof Vietnam, covering 54 sq.m., featured the five provinces of Dien Bien, Ninh Binh,Nghe An, Ha Tinh and Quang Binh and three travel companies who introduced anumber of tourism products to regional and international businesses.

Data from the Ministry ofCulture, Sports and Tourism showed that about 2.1 million of the 12.6million international visitors to Vietnam in 2023 came from the ASEAN countries.

Given this, at this year’sevent, Vietnam also looked to popularise its tourism images to attract moretravellers from the ASEAN members since with a combined population of 670 million, thebloc is a potential market for travel companies of Vietnam as well as regionalcountries.

Minister of Culture, Sports and Tourism Nguyen Van Hung told the Vietnam News Agency's resident correspondents on January 25 thatintra-ASEAN tourism is highly important and holds favourable conditions such asmany cultural similarities, beautiful landscapes, and hospitable people. These areadvantages for attracting tourists from both the member countries and others across the world. To do that, each nation needs to step up the introduction of itsbeauty and potential.

He alsohighly valued the Vietnamese localities and businesses taking part in the fair,which, he said, was a chance to advertise the country’s tourism potential and strengthsto international friends to help reach this year’s target of 17 - 18 millioninternational tourist arrivals./.
